COMPANY PROFILE

CCNI was established in 1930, when two companies based in Punta Arenas, Chile, decided to create Compañía Chilena de Navegación Interoceánica in Valparaíso, in order to provide maritime services between South Atlantic and South Pacific ports through the Strait of Magellan.
On March 31, 1930, Supreme Decree No. 1.684 was published in the Official Gazette, stipulating the legal status of Compañía Chilena de Navegación Interoceánica S.A., signed by His Excellency the President of the Republic, Mr. Carlos Ibáñez del Campo. The initial fleet was made up by the steamships “Valparaíso”, “Santiago” and “Atacama”, which, altogether, totaled 11,676 registered tons. Up to the early 1950s, the Company focused its attention on American countries and, in 1953, it offered a regular service to the North American Pacific, which started in Chile and served ports in Peru, Ecuador, Colombia, Central America, Mexico, United States and Canada. In 1946, the Company started an important fleet renovation plan, purchasing four C1-MA-V1 type vessels in the United States that had been used during World War II.
